| Two law firms have dropped a dispute about expenses in long-running litigation over respiratory diseases and other injuries suffered as a result of rescue and debris-removal operations following the Sept. 11, 2001, terrorist attack in New York. The dispute was over so-called "common benefit costs," which would have reduced the amount of lawyers fees in the case. |
